Small products place exceptional demands on conveying technology. Prolink S13 combines a small 8-mm pitch with precise transfers and diverse surfaces As a result, you can convey light to medium-weight food and non-food products reliably and gently.
“When it comes to applications with very small transfer gaps, Prolink S13 is a versatile specialist. The belt runs over rolling or fixed knife edges up to a minimum radius of 3 mm. Therefore, even small and sensitive products move smoothly and precisely from one process step to the next. This series is exceptionally flexible in conveying, drying or cooling processes.”

The small, 8-mm pitch enables outstandingly tight transfer gaps. This aspect pays dividends, particularly with small, lightweight or sensitive products. Knife edges with small radii encourage fluid transfers and reduce critical distances between two conveying sections.
Smooth, patterned or with an open area: Prolink S13 delivers diverse belt surfaces for a range of tasks. The inverted pyramid pattern encourages the release of wet or sticky products. Cone Tops improve grip. The open version with an open area of 34% boosts airflow and drainage. As a result, you can customize the belt to products and processes.
The design of the underside of the belt and sprockets boosts reliable tooth engagement, belt tracking and cleaning friendliness. Headless hinge pins facilitate fitting and maintenance. The ProSnap version also allows quick and tool-free opening and closing of the belt.

At just 8 mm, the series 13 has one of the tightest pitches in the Prolink range. This very small pitch enables exceptionally tight transfer gaps. As a result, the belt can move even very small and sensitive products gently and smoothly. Therefore, the belt’s ideal for conveying lightweight products in the food and many more industries.
PA and POM are standard materials used. But PA-HT, which can withstand higher temperatures and PXX-HC as a self-extinguishing, highly conductive material, are also optionally available. These options mean the belt can adapt to the demands of diverse temperatures and applications, ranging from -45°C to +155°C, depending on the material chosen.
Series 13 was tailored to applications with knife edges and enables a return over rolling or fixed knife edges up to a minimum radius of just 3 mm. Therefore, the belt can transfer the smallest of products precisely. The belt is also ideal for conveying, drying and cooling.
Yes, the belt is NSF compliant, and belts made of POM, PA and PA-HT meet the requirements of the FDA 21 CFR regulation, the EU directives (EU) 10/2011 and (EC) 1935/2004 and the Japanese MHLW 370 regulation. NSF certification applies to production in the Forbo Huntersville (US), Malacky (Slovakia) and Tlalnepantla (Mexico) plants.
There are four types, depending on the application: S13-0 FLT with a closed, smooth surface for standard usage, S13-0 NPY with an inverted pyramid pattern that releases wet or sticky products superbly, the S13-0 CTP with a Cone Top for excellent grip and the S13-34 FLT with a 34% open area for outstanding airflow and drainage.
The sophisticated design of the teeth and belt underside means superior tooth engagement, reliable belt tracking and a belt that’s easy to clean. The belt and sprocket design are engineered to work in tandem and guarantee good power transmission and tensile force.
The hinge pins are headless, which makes fitting and dismantling the belt during maintenance much easier. ProSnap is a quick-release solution allowing easy and tool-free opening and closing of the belt – even across the whole belt width.
The sprockets (S13 SPR) come in five sizes ranging from Z15 to Z48, with diameters of around 39 mm to 124 mm. They are available with round and square axle diameters, making the flexible to fit to diverse conveyor concepts.
